Considering Complimentary P2P Titles: Permissible Choices & Secure Options
While the allure of no-cost P2P games is undeniable, venturing into that territory often carries significant safe and protection risks. Copyright infringement is a serious matter, and downloading titles illegally can result in hefty fines and other consequences. Thankfully, numerous permissible and reliable choices exist for accessing incredible gaming experiences without breaking the law or exposing your computer to malware. Platforms like Steam, Epic Games Store, GOG.com, and Humble Bundle frequently offer no-cost titles or deeply discounted sales. Moreover, many developers offer complimentary "demo" versions or early access programs, allowing you to try out games before committing to a purchase. Remember that prioritizing legal avenues not only supports publishers but also keeps your digital presence protected.
